Classic Confrontation

Game 3 of the SJHL final was a beaut. It had it all and just as fans were settling in for a 4th period, it was over. The La Ronge Ice Wolves beat the Yorkton Terriers 4-3 to take a 2-1 series lead in a game that was shown live across Saskatchewan on Access 7 as the league showcased itself and what it can be all about.

It was a back and forth affair, it had great hits, great saves, good action and a little controversy as well. In the end, the league's top two players---Travis Eggum and Marc Andre-Carre--came in on a 2 on 1 with Eggum banging it past Yorkton's Devin Peters to take the victory. They will look to win Game 4 tonight (Access 7-7:30 puck drop) knowing a win and they could wrap things up at home. The Terriers will be trying to make sure the two teams are back in Yorkton Sunday night for a Game 6. The way this series has gone, I wouldn't be surprised.
